Overview

Jessica Clinton Park is a primary athletic hub in Port St. Lucie, Florida, featuring a dedicated complex for organized sports. The facility includes two lighted baseball fields, two lighted soccer fields, and two tennis courts. A multipurpose recreational building serves as the administrative and operational center for park activities. The park provides a playground area for children and walking paths throughout the grounds. It is named in memory of Jessica Clinton, a local student athlete who passed away from a heart condition, serving as a tribute to her community involvement. The park is managed by the Port St. Lucie Parks & Recreation Department and is a site for youth league play. The site is situated within a residential district near the Southbend area. It maintains standardized lighting for evening sporting events.

Insider tips

Bring portable folding chairs if you are attending a tournament, as bleacher seating at the sports fields can fill up quickly.

Check the City of Port St. Lucie's online athletic schedule before visiting to ensure fields are not reserved for private league play.

Apply sunscreen and insect repellent, as the open field areas offer limited natural shade.
